PHASE V The Lair of the Magi PHASE VI The Realms of Mind's Chaos PHASE VII The Finale PLOT: You are as the introduction shows, Sir David, a knight in the service of King Frederick. Sent to Green Row to help his brother King Weeden discover what has happened to his missing towns people you are about to enter a huge six level dungeon full of monsters, traps, and puzzles. CONTROL: Start: Pauses game and brings up menu screen. A: Confirm and use magic B: To slash sword, talk, and cancel C: To jump and confirm. B and C can be used to do a jump slash or a jump thrust. Dropped L5 Ninja MAGIC Spell Name Elements Wind...........AIR-Small burst of wind causes damage to a single enemy. Fire...........FIRE-Causes minor burns to one opponent. Firewind.......AIR, FIRE-Fiery blast forms around one enemy, causing major damage. Earthquake.....EARTH-Ground shakes under opponents, causing damage. Thunder........AIR, EARTH-Deafening roar blasts enemies. Meteor.........FIRE, EARTH-Bouncing fireball inflicts heavy damage on enemies. Needlecrack....AIR, FIRE, EARTH-Energy rays cause serious damage to enemies. Heal...........WATER-Restores several of your Hit Points. Ice............AIR, WATER-Freezes a single opponent for a short time. Cure...........FIRE, WATER- Cures you of any poison. Confuse........AIR, FIRE, WATER- Enemies are greatly damaged, and helpless for a short time. Guardian.......EARTH, WATER- A sprite acts as your shield. After a few hits, it disappears. Turn Undead....AIR, EARTH, WATER- Instantly destroys a single undead creature. Shield........ FIRE, EARTH, WATER- A shell of energy protects you on all sides. After several hits it disappears. Judgement......AIR, FIRE, EARTH, WATER- Repulses all enemies in the path of the spell, causing serious damage. A must have. Talisman- In possession of King Weeden, this item nullifies magic barriers. GENERAL CLUES/ADVICE IMPORTANT!!! Go into MODE and set it so you can see damage received and dealt!!! This helps later on. Attack from behind for more damage, but watch your back. NEVER EVER turn off auto item use. Annoying at first, but you'll realize how useful it is in a pitched battle. Save often. Heal often. Use the level 2 fountain in the center and save point as your base until you reach level 5. Shops exist in the town and in the shrine. To trade you may need gold, items or credentials. Buy magic as needed. Don't be afraid to use spells. Show no mercy. Enemies drop food, gold, and rare equipment. In water you can't cast or slash. PHASE I- Level 1 Contains: 3 Life Max, Rapier, and the resale cat. Bosses: 2 Once in the dungeon head SE. After a lasering the door, you'll fight 3 goblins. Defeat them for the Key 1. Use a slash and retreat pattern if you're having trouble. NW of the start you'll find a room of slimes. Head NE to a room with 3 doors. Use Key 1 to open the locked door. Explore to find a room with Air and a switch. Hit the switch and return to the 3 door room. North of it is a room with a chest. Jump up and around the pillar its on to get a Life Max. Take the south door from this room to find a prisoner and a Fountain. The fountain is your third best friend. Return and take the north door. Learn to love the lily pad monster. They are tough to fight in water, but drop gold (110), fish, Air and Water, and the Gold Armour, which is the best in the game. If your lucky enough to get it the game is much easier. Beyond this water room is a save point. In the room with four lights, hit all four with your sword. A secret door will appear leading to the resale cat, who buys items from you. Return and proceed to the NW door. BOSS Mother Pod Creature. Slash the eye repeatedly. Collect fire and chicken from the spheres. When he glows red watch out for it's about to use a fire attack. He takes some practice, but falls easily. You'll want lots of fillet and steak before you fight him. In the next room get Life Max and Key 2. South in the fire room is a red potion. Head SW and use Key 2 to open the door. Past the water room is a mage who animates 4 skeletons. The skeletons are near invincible, but if you use turn undead, or just kill the mage they die. Further on you'll meet the Barrel. Push it next to the door and slash for a 3 count and boom! In this room with the gargoyle. Go NW to free the prisoner and then go NE for a simple barrel puzzle. In the new room throw the switch and the door will open in the room with the prisoner. In this new room hide behind the pillars until the wind dies. In the middle on the north side is a save point. Go NE and onward. In the room with the rotating blocks you'll need to hone your pushing skills. The next room has the stairs down and wraiths. Deal with the wraiths for now with a sword or turn undead. Move north. Go NE for a fountain and then go NW for a simple barrel puzzle to collect the Rapier. Equip it and head SE then NE. Answer the riddle by extinguishing all 4 lights. Collect 700g and a red potion. Beyond is a boss. BOSS Red Dragon. Stay on the north block and slash his head, or use Needlecrack. Run under him when he breaths fire. He dies with some patience. Collect a Life Max and free a prisoner. Listen to what he says. The next room has a teleporter that will take you back to the castle. Talk with King Weeden, buy goods, and then save. Hopefully at this point you can buy the Relayer for 1500g. If not fight lilies for gold and hopefully gold armour.
